The Heat is On: Thermal Throttling Concerns

One of the primary drivers behind the alleged increase in returns is the issue of thermal throttling. High-end CPUs, like the Intel Core i9, generate significant heat, and if this heat isn’t effectively dissipated, the processor will reduce its clock speed to prevent damage. Gamers are reporting that even with high-end cooling solutions, their Intel Core i9 CPUs are still reaching thermal limits, resulting in performance degradation. This is particularly problematic for users who overclock their CPUs to achieve maximum performance.

  • Inadequate cooling solutions
  • Poor case airflow
  • High ambient temperatures

These factors can all contribute to thermal throttling and a less-than-ideal gaming experience.

Performance Inconsistencies: A Source of Frustration

Beyond thermal issues, some gamers are also reporting inconsistencies in performance. While the Core i9 CPUs boast impressive specifications on paper, real-world performance can vary significantly depending on the game, the system configuration, and even the specific batch of CPU. This variability can lead to frustration, as gamers expect a consistent and reliable experience from a high-end processor.

Potential Causes of Performance Variability:

  • Game engine optimization
  • Driver issues
  • System memory configuration
